Cape Elizabeth's proximity to the ocean means homes are exposed to salt air, high humidity, and nor'easters, which can accelerate corrosion and mold growth after a water event. Restoration timelines can be extended, especially in winter, as proper drying requires managing indoor humidity against cold, damp exterior conditions to prevent secondary damage like mold in wall cavities.
The primary challenges are seasonal and weather-driven. Winter brings ice dams, frozen pipe bursts, and storm-driven coastal flooding, while summer humidity can exacerbate mold issues from spring rains. Fall is often the busiest season for fire damage restoration due to increased use of heating systems and fireplaces, so scheduling repairs during this peak time may involve longer waits.
Yes, Cape Elizabeth has many historic and coastal properties, which may fall under local historic preservation guidelines or stricter shoreland zoning ordinances. For any significant structural restoration, especially after fire or flood, you may need permits from the Cape Elizabeth Planning Department, and materials/replacement may need to meet specific aesthetic or environmental standards to preserve community character.
Prioritize companies with an IICRC certification and local, physical offices, as they understand regional building codes and can respond quickly. Verify they are fully insured and licensed in Maine. It's also wise to choose a provider experienced with the common local issues like historic home materials, coastal moisture, and working with Maine's unique insurance landscape.
Costs in Southern Maine, including Cape Elizabeth, are typically at or above the national average due to higher labor and material costs, especially for specialty trades. Emergency water extraction can start in the thousands, while full fire/smoke remediation can reach tens of thousands. Always get a detailed, written estimate and confirm your homeowner's insurance policy details, as coverage varies greatly for flood vs. sudden water damage.
